Description

Warwick District Council is procuring a new contract for responsive repairs and void maintenance via a competitive flexible procedure. The contract is responsive repairs reported by customers, repairs to void properties, in addition to other work streams identified in the scope of the contract. The aim is Improving services for repairs, voids, HHSRS, Damp and Mould, and Compliance are all part of the action plan agreed with the Regulator and are reflected in the term brief It is, therefore, essential for WDC to: • Ensure it can meet the Regulator for Social Housing's Consumer Standards • Ensure contracts deliver a customer-focused, efficient, and effective service • Fully comply with all statutory and compliance requirements relating to Building Safety • Provide an effective service to address Legal Disrepair claims and Housing Health and Safety Rating System Hazards • Put in place effective services to deal with Awaab’s Law • Appoint suitable contractors with experience and expertise in social housing repairs and maintenance to provide an effective value-for-money service to WDC • Ensure its contracting arrangements are fit for the future and allow innovation to be optimised Key objectives for this contract are: • Mobilisation is achieved on time and to the specified requirements • Ensure WDC can meet the Regulator for Social Housing's Consumer Standards for repairing and maintaining its housing stock • Ensure that the new contract delivers customer-focused, efficient, and effective repairs, maintenance, and voids maintenance service • Customer Satisfaction is met to an agreed standard • Ensure this arrangement assists the Council to fully comply with all statutory and compliance requirements relating to Building Safety • Provides a dedicated, targeted, and effective service to address Legal Disrepair claims and Housing Health and Safety Rating System Hazards • Provides a highly effective service to deal with Damp and Mould cases in line with Awaab’s Law • Ensure the arrangement is fit for the future and allows innovation to be optimised • Ensuring the contracted specification is delivered to the required standards • Void repairs are not marginalised • All workstreams are delivered within the agreed timescales specified in the Term Brief • Ensure comprehensive documentation and record keeping and provide key evidence to demonstrate compliance to the regulator Contract value is approximately £110 million (including extensions and future workstreams). Contract length is 15 years (5+5+5).
